Description:
IF60 is a 60 minute fire seal, which provides primary protection for single and double leaf, single and double acting fire doors. It is also used in conjunction with IMP seals at the meeting stiles on double doors.

The seal is extruded aluminium alloy  and contains two reservoirs, each having substantial reserves of Sealmaster intumescent material.

When heat from the fire reaches the IF60 seal, the 
intumescent foams, swells and fills the gaps around the door frame. As the foam remains soft during the period of intumescent action, it has the ability to re-seal the gap, should the door warp or be moved for any reason.

IF60 was tested by TRADA. It was fitted with a 60 minute door assembly and achieve an integrity rating of 71 minutes. IF60 fire seals have been tested and approved by Certifire to conform to BS476 part 22. This is the most demanding 3rd party certification scheme in the industry.

Maintenance:

All interested parties, designer, specifier, main contractor and specialist installers should provide access to allow the fire stopping seals to be regularly inspected and maintained, as well as records kept of such maintenance at minimum periods of 12 months, as required by the Regulatory Reform Order, and repaired if necessary. Reference should be made to ASFP TGD 17 Code of Practice for the Installation and Inspection of Fire Stopping.

Competency:

It is vital that those entrusted to design or install a fire stopping product have the necessary levels of competence to undertake the task professionally and thoroughly. The level of competency required will be commensurate with the expected complexity of the building. All designers must eliminate, reduce or control foreseeable risks that may arise during installation, construction or maintenance when preparing or modifying designs. Clients should ensure that the principal designer and principal contractor carry out their duties under CDM regulations. The ASFP foundation course in passive fire protection provides essential knowledge as part of demonstrating competency and understanding in this key fire protection specialism.
